The Federal Bailiff Service has seized the Russian property of Alexei Poroshenko, the son of former President of Ukraine Petro Poroshenko.
This is reported by the RIA Novosti news agency, referring to the database of enforcement proceedings of the FSSP of the Russian Federation. It follows from the report that the relevant enforcement proceedings were initiated in January 2024.
It is known that a special department in the FSSP, the main interregional (specialized) department of the service, is engaged in record keeping regarding the property of Alexei Poroshenko.
Recall that in July, the director of the FSSP Dmitry Aristov of the Russian Federation announced the transfer to the income of the Russian state of shares of a confectionery factory in the Lipetsk region, owned by the former President of Ukraine Petro Poroshenko and his son, as well as the assets of two companies belonging to the Ukrainian oligarch Igor Kolomoisky❶.
